Indiana Fever guard Sophie Cunningham didn’t wait for the post-game press conference to celebrate. Moments after the Fever beat the Minnesota Lynx 74-59 to lift their first Commissioner’s Cup, the 28-year-old turned to a teammate’s Instagram Live, dropped into a quick twerk, and sent social media into a frenzy. Clips of the dance hit X, TikTok, and Instagram within minutes, racking up thousands of views before most fans even knew the final score.

Why the video blew up

Cunningham’s move happened in real time, streaming straight from the locker room to fans’ phones. The dance felt spontaneous, not staged, which made it easy to share. Fever followers have already rallied around Cunningham for her tough play and lively personality, so the moment fit her growing image.

A party with a purpose

The celebration was loud for good reason. Each player pockets a piece of the $500,000 prize pool that comes with the Cup. Even injured rookie star Caitlin Clark joined in, spraying champagne while teammates debated the next song on the playlist. But it was Cunningham’s 15-second dance that viewers kept replaying.

What it means for the Fever

Indiana has spent two seasons rebuilding around young talent. Tuesday’s win and the viral buzz that followed signal a team moving from promise to presence.
Cunningham’s social-media moment may not add points to the standings, but it pushes the Fever deeper into the public eye, right when women’s basketball is grabbing more attention than ever.Sophie Cunningham scored 13 points in the final, then scored a bigger victory online. And in a league where highlights and hashtags often spread faster than box scores, one short twerk may do as much for the Fever’s profile as the shiny new trophy.
